What might 23 ROSE CLOSE be worth now?

23 ROSE C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£119,463.

This is based on house price inflation of 34.2%, between June 2015 and April 2026, for flats, in the City of Derby local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 34.2%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 23 ROSE CLOSE of £89,000 on 18th June 2015. For the value to have increased from £89,000 to £119,463 over the eleven years and two months to April 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 23 ROSE C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for flats in the City of Derby local authority area.
  • The June 2015 sale price of £89,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 23 ROSE CLOSE has not materially changed since June 2015.
